About This Classic 1997 Edition

For Your Garden: Shade Gardens by Warren Schultz, published by Barnes & Noble Books in 1997, offers an insightful exploration into the art of shade gardening. This hardcover edition, printed in New York, provides practical advice and inspiration for gardeners looking to cultivate beautiful landscapes in shaded areas. Warren Schultz, a respected voice in horticulture, guides readers through plant selection, design techniques, and maintenance tips tailored for low-light environments. This edition, identified by ISBN 0-7607-0501-1, is an accessible resource for both novice and experienced gardeners. While this is not a first edition, its comprehensive content and practical approach make it a valuable addition to any gardening library.
